Epidural steroid injections contain drugs that mimic the effects of the hormones cortisone and hydrocortisone. When injected near irritated nerves in your spine, these drugs may temporarily reduce inflammation and help relieve pain.

WebKaposi's sarcoma has been reported in patients receiving immunosuppressive therapy, most of whom are organ transplant recipients. The development of Kaposi's sarcoma after treatment with corticosteroids has been reported in only 38 patients who have not had acquired immunodeficiency syndrome or undergone organ transplantation. A repeat . celiac plexus nerve block biography about alexander the greatWebOct 22, 2024 · Injecting the local anesthetic into the medial nerve helps healthcare providers diagnose back pain. If the injection relieves at least 50% of your usual back pain, your healthcare provider will likely confirm that the pain is coming from the facet joint and recommend radiofrequency ablation as treatment.
